网站建设服务热线 服务热线: 0571-88730320
网站建设公司
您的当前位置: 首页 » 网站设计 » 移动网站——前端开发布局技巧总结

移动网站——前端开发布局技巧总结

发布时间:2021-01-08 18:02:30

自从iPhone和Android这两款功能强大的移动操作系统发布以来,互联网**又增加了一个新名词——webapp(即运行在高等移动终端设备上的基于web的应用程序)。

开发者都知道高等智能手机系统中有两种应用:一种是基于本地(操作系统)运行的app;另一种是基于高等浏览器运行的webapp。本文将主要解释后者。

webapp和原生app有什么区别?

1开发成本非常高。常用的开发语言有Java、C++、Objective-C。

2更新体验差,麻烦。每次发布新版本,都需要用户手动打包更新(有些应用程序即使不需要用户手动更新,也需要一个恶心的提示)。

3这很酷,因为nativeapp可以调用IOS中的UI控件来使用UI方法。它可以实现一些webapp无法实现的非常酷的交互效果

4Nativeapp被苹果公司认可。Nativeapp可以被苹果视为一款值得信赖的独立软件,可以在applestroe中销售,但webapp不能。维护是比较容易的,就像一般的网站,维护也比较简单,其实就是一个网站

换句话说,它使用HTML、HTML应用程序、HTML、CSS和HTML来优化web站点。

当然,由于这些高等智能手机(iPhone和Android)的内置浏览器都是基于WebKit内核的,所以在开发webapp时,大多数都使用HTML5和CSS3技术进行UI布局。在使用HTML5和css3l作为用户界面时,如果仍然沿用一般web开发中使用html4和CSS2的开发方法,就会失去webapp的本质意义,有些效果无法实现,所以我们回到我们的主题–webapp的布局和技术。

1首先,让我们看看WebKit内核中的一些私有meta标记。这些元标记在webapp.1234的开发中起着非常重要的作用

2使用HTML5标签在编写webapp之初,我建议前端工程师使用HTML5而不是html4,因为HTML5可以实现一些html4无法实现的丰富web应用体验,可以减少开发人员的大量工作量。当然,在你决定使用HTML5之前,你必须非常熟悉它,并且知道HTML5新标签的作用。例如,节标签可用于定义内容或文章区域,导航标签可用于定义导航栏或选项卡,等等。

3在项目开发过程中放弃cssflot属性,可能会遇到内容编排和显示的布局问题。如果你遇到这样的视觉草稿,我建议你放弃浮动直接使用它显示:块;

4使用CSS3边界背景属性,此按钮具有圆形效果、内部发光效果和高亮效果。这样的按钮不能用CSS3编写。当然,圆角可以用CSS3编写,但是高光和内部辉光不能用CSS3编写。此时,可以使用-WebKit border image来定义此按钮的样式。-WebKit border image是一个非常复杂的样式属性。


海口浩豚建站公司 地址:浙江省杭州市余杭区联胜路10号 电话:0571-88730320 联系人:方经理